Credits: 4 Prerequisite: none INTD670 will review and analyze the concepts of leadership versus managerial roles and responsibilities and examine how societal expectations for ethical behavior and regulatory scrutiny of ethical conduct affect both leaders and managers in an organizational setting. This course will differentiate among decision problems and ethical decision-making processes and address issues related to managing conflicts within a decision making process. Students will also examine a variety of complex ethical issues confronting industry professionals as they work with various stakeholders of an organization. Additionally, students will explore the 'Code of Conduct' at work, issues related to managing conflicts of interests within a decision making process, differentiate among decision problems and ethical decision making.
